MYRTLE BEACH, S.C.-- The Wartburg men's outdoor track and field team took fifth with 34 points at the NCAA Championships.

Notes:
- Love earned his third career All-American honor in the 110 hurdles
- Highest finish on the podium for Love in this event
- Also the highest finish on the podium in this event for the program
- This was Collet's second career All-American honor in the 5K
- First All-American honor for the program since 2022
- This was the 12th and 13th All-American honor in the 5K for the program
